Good News: A new study indicates that internal combustion engine vehicle sales is in “terminal decline” thanks to an upswing in electric vehicle sales! Link HERE. The Good Word: A truly important quote from Her Majesty, Queen Elizabeth II. Good To Know: A surprising bit of information about vanilla! Good News: Recent analysis ranks the […]